How'd That Taste?
One my pet peeves is when somebody tastes something and says "yuck, that's terrible!" and then tries to hand it to me while asking "do you want it?" Sure, with a ringing endorsement like that who wouldn't want it. I was reminded of this as I read John McClain's latest column regarding erstwhile Texan Phillip Buchanon. In essence, the Raiders drafted a can of Buchanon Cola, tasted it, said "Yuck!" and then turned to the rest of the NFL to see if anybody wanted some. The Texans did. So did the Redskins according to McClain. That should be red flag number two.
Player evaluation is more of an art than a science as it is currently practiced. And certainly there have been times when a change of scenery has turned around a player's performance but in hindsight the Texan's signing of Buchanon defies logic. Only Charley Casserly could sign a player that 1. The Raiders said could not play (the Raiders!) and 2. The Redskins wanted. I guess the "coaches wanted him."
